Git本地倉庫(Repository)詳解

2021-09-10 17:40:44 字數 3303 閱讀 1911

大綱:

一、前言

二、概述

三、在windows上安裝git

四、建立本地倉庫

五、本地倉庫管理詳解

六、總結

一、前言

本來呢,其實呢。我以為git也就幾個命令,沒什麼難的。於是就到網上找了些文章看看,發現這些文章難得不知道該說什麼好。不是簡單的寫幾個命令,就是直接複製貼上手冊中的內容,沒有一點連續感,不知道從何學起。總之呢,我想寫乙個什麼都不會的朋友能看懂的、初學朋友能看懂的、運維能看懂的、開發也能看懂的,看完就能幹活的教程。

二、概述

git 本地倉庫詳解

git 遠端倉庫詳解

git 分支管理詳解

git 標籤管理詳解

github 使用詳解

git 全域性配置詳解

git與github總結

注,本教程呢,只能讓你會使用git幹活,至於你呢想深入了解git,或者想成為git領域的專家喲,我想說這只是個起步。還有我想說git只是個工具嘛,目的只是為了提高我們的工作效率,我們沒有必要去,也不需要學浪費時間在研究工具上,只要我們會用就好,嘿嘿!也許有博友不同意啊,只是個人見解啊,勿噴啊!

三、在windows上安裝git

好了,到這裡我們的git就安裝完成了,嘿嘿!下面我們來進行基本配置:

注,我這裡根據我的情況設定如下(如上圖):

1.$ git config --global user.name"chenmingqian"

2.$ git config --global user.email 「[email protected]

四、建立本地倉庫

1.版本庫又稱倉庫

版本庫或者是倉庫,英文名repository,其實啊說白了就是乙個目錄而且,這個目錄中的所以檔案都被git管理而且,不管你做什麼操作都會被記錄,包括:增加、刪除、修改檔案等,都會被記錄下來,以便後來跟蹤與修改相關記錄,甚至被還原。好了,下面我們就在我們客戶端(我這裡演示的是windows客戶端,其它客戶端操作一樣)中建立乙個版本庫:

大家可以看到我們在/c/users/root/下建立乙個空目錄pro即可project簡寫。還有一點需要說明的在windows系統中目錄名稱不要使用中文,不然會出現神馬問題,我不負責。嘿嘿^_^……

2.目錄變成倉庫

執行git init命令,即可initialized empty git repository in c:/users/root/pro/.git/,初始化乙個空目錄,路徑為c:/users/root/pro/.git/。大家可以看到pro目錄中生成了乙個隱藏目錄 .git目錄,進入目錄中大家可以看到裡面有很多檔案,沒事不要修改或者改動裡機的檔案,這裡面的檔案就是控制和管理版本庫的,嘿嘿。至於裡檔案的具體作用我們會在後面的文章中講解,想提前了解的朋友可以先google一下。

3.向本地倉庫中增加檔案

注意,新建的readme.txt檔案,一定要在pro目錄,不然git無法管理這裡檔案哦,嘿嘿!下面我們把個檔案放到版本庫中。

1).git status 命令

我們先用git status命令檢視一下,如上圖。大家可以看到git記錄我們新增加乙個檔案readme.txt,並且提示這個檔案還沒有被提交。下面我們用git add命令提交一下。

2).git add 命令

git add 命令是告訴git,我們要把什麼檔案提交到倉庫中去,大家可以看我們執行git add readme.txt命令後,沒有任何提示。那就說明我們提交完成了。下面我們通過git commit命令,將readme.txt檔案提交到版本庫中。

3).git commit 命令

1.$ git commit -m"add readme.txt"

2.[master (root-commit) e5d662b] add readme.

3.1filechanged, 3 insertions(+)

4.create mode 100644 readme.txt

大家可以看到我們用git commit命令提交readme.txt檔案,給出的提示是 1 file changed, 3 insertions(+),乙個檔案改變,插入了三行內容。與我們上面增加三行內容一致。嘿嘿!下面我們簡單的說明一下git commit命令,其中的引數-m後面輸入的是本次提交的版本說明,可以輸入任意內容,但需要說明的是,最好寫有意義的說明,便於以後檢視。

4).git status 命令

最後我們再用git status命令檢視一下版本庫的狀態,提示沒有任何內容需要提交說明我們向版本庫增加檔案成功了,嘿嘿。

4.總結

1).初始化乙個git倉庫,使用git init命令

2).新增檔案到本地git倉中,分為兩步:

git 本地倉庫

git是當前最流行的版本控制軟體 在本地安裝git 檢查是否安裝git git version 1.建立倉庫 在本地建立乙個資料夾,裡面放上要放在git倉庫中管理的檔案,在命令列提示符中,進入到該資料夾下,執行命令git init 這是把該普通的資料夾初始化成git倉庫,通過輸出可以檢視初始畫的是乙...

git本地倉庫

預設的位置是在你所安裝git的目錄下。git的倉庫你可以建在你電腦的任何目錄下 最好不要包含有中文目錄 通過命令列cd指定到你想要的目錄下,例如 cd g git上面的命令將指定到g盤下git資料夾內。當然git目錄是我事先建好的資料夾,你也可以先指定到g,再在g盤下建立新的目錄,使用命令列mkdi...

git刪除本地倉庫

現在本機上有個本地倉庫 root test01 h2 20151112 cd h2 root test01 h2 git branch develop 執行git init命令 root test01 h2 20151112 git init reinitialized existing git r...